7 Photoreceptors (PR) Transduction Rods achromatic Cones color ~

8 Photoreceptors - PR Dark current Depolarized in dark Na+ influx
NT is released BP inhibited ~

9 Photoreceptors - PR Light strikes PR Receptor potential
hyperpolarization  NT release BP depolarizes  NT release Excites RGC  APs ~

10 Rods Around edges of retina 120 million Pigment = rhodopsin
Convergence high sensitivity low acuity ~

11 Cones Color vision - 3 types red = long wavelength green = medium
blue = short 6 million Concentrated in fovea Little convergence low sensitivity high acuity ~
